释义与例句

n.
  1. 1.

    A name for an inhabitant or native of a specific place, usually derived from the name of the place.

    区域居民称谓词

    当地居民嘅嗌法

    人民号名

    Why is it that people from the United States use American as their demonym?

  2. 2.

    A pseudonym formed of an adjective.

    废旧

    The Logophile has my favourite demonym; I would write under it if he didn't.

词源

From demo- + -onym, from Ancient Greek δῆμος (dêmos, “people”) + ὄνυμα (ónuma, “name”). Possibly revived in 1997 by Paul Dickson of Merriam-Webster.
